Soft vs Pressure Washing: Choosing the Best Exterior Cleaning Method

Soft washing combines low-pressure water and cleaning agents to remove contaminants gently, protecting fragile materials. Pressure washing uses high-pressure jets to remove dirt and grime from hard surfaces but can damage delicate finishes.

MethodPressure LevelSuitable Surfaces
Soft WashingLowRoofs, siding, decks
Pressure WashingHighConcrete, brick, stone

How Does Soft Washing Use Low-Pressure Water and Cleaning Agents?

Soft washing applies low-pressure water with biodegradable agents that break down mold and algae, allowing contaminants to rinse away without harming materials. It’s ideal for roofs and painted siding, where high pressure can cause peeling or cracking.

What Risks Are Associated with High-Pressure Power Washing?

Pressure washing removes stubborn dirt but carries risks. High-pressure jets can damage wood, painted surfaces, and other delicate materials, possibly requiring costly repairs. Improper use also creates hazards from flying debris or slips. Evaluate surface type and condition before use.

What Are the Benefits of Soft Washing for Residential and Commercial Properties?

Soft washing helps preserve building materials by using low pressure and safe cleaning agents, which reduces the chance of damage and extends surface lifespan. It also removes contaminants that can affect occupant health, contributing to a cleaner, safer environment.

How Does Soft Washing Safely Remove Algae, Mold, and Dirt?

Soft washing uses low pressure and biodegradable agents to break down organic matter and rinse contaminants away, suitable for roofs and siding.

Why Is Soft Washing Environmentally Responsible in Central California?

In Central California, soft washing is environmentally responsible: biodegradable agents reduce chemical runoff and protect local ecosystems. It also uses less water than pressure washing, making it a more sustainable option.

When Should You Choose Pressure Washing Over Soft Washing?

Pressure washing is the better choice when surfaces can withstand high pressure, such as concrete driveways and brick patios. It is effective at removing heavy stains and built-up grime that soft washing may not fully address.

What Surfaces and Contaminants Are Suitable for Pressure Washing?

Pressure washing suits rugged surfaces that tolerate high-pressure cleaning. Common applications include:

  1. Concrete: Effectively removes oil stains and dirt buildup.
  2. Brick: Cleans without damaging the surface when done correctly.
  3. Stone: Ideal for patios and walkways that require deep cleaning.

What Are the Potential Surface Damage Risks of Pressure Washing?

High-pressure jets can strip paint, etch softer materials, and force water into vulnerable areas, causing intrusion. Assess surface type and condition carefully to avoid damage.

How Do Soft Washing and Pressure Washing Compare in Cost and Longevity?

Each method offers different advantages for cost and longevity. Soft washing usually has a lower upfront cost and delivers longer-lasting results due to its thorough treatment. Pressure washing may require more frequent repeat cleanings, which can increase long-term costs.

What Is the Cost Difference Between Soft Washing and Pressure Washing?

Soft washing generally ranges from $0.15 to $0.35 per sq ft, while pressure washing ranges from $0.25 to $0.75 per sq ft, depending on surface and cleaning level. This highlights soft washing’s affordability for larger areas.

How Long Do Soft Washing Results Typically Last Compared to Pressure Washing?

Soft washing results typically last longer than pressure washing. Pressure washing may need repeat cleanings every few months, whereas soft washing can keep surfaces clean for 12 to 18 months, depending on conditions.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use soft washing on all types of surfaces?

Soft washing is safe for many but not all surfaces. Best for delicate materials (roofs, painted siding, wood); not ideal for heavy soiling or deep-clean surfaces like concrete or brick. Assess surface and condition before choosing.

How often should I schedule soft washing for my property?

Frequency depends on exposure and material. Generally, schedule soft washing every 12–18 months. Properties in humid or polluted areas may need more frequent cleanings; inspect regularly to set the right schedule.

Is pressure washing safe for all surfaces?

No. Pressure washing works for tough materials like concrete and brick but can damage wood, vinyl siding, and painted areas. High-pressure jets can strip paint, etch surfaces, or force water into structures. Consult a professional to assess suitability.

What are the environmental impacts of pressure washing?

Pressure washing can cause runoff of chemicals and dislodged debris to enter storm drains and waterways, harming ecosystems. It also uses more water than soft washing. Use eco-friendly agents and containment to reduce impacts.

Can I perform soft washing myself, or should I hire a professional?

DIY soft washing is possible, but hiring a professional is recommended. Pros have proper equipment, product knowledge, and experience to avoid damage. If DIY, follow safety guidelines and use appropriate products.

What should I do to prepare my property for soft washing?

Remove outdoor furniture, decorations, and plants that could be affected. Close windows and doors, cover electrical outlets and fixtures, and tell your cleaning service about any concerns so they can plan safely.
